首页
/ 推荐一款强大的MVP开发框架 - Appy

推荐一款强大的MVP开发框架 - Appy

2024-05-24 21:36:34作者:宣利权Counsellor

Appy 是一款全方位的Web应用模板,专为快速开发最小可行性产品(MVP)而设计。它结合了前端的 Vue.js 框架和后台的 Hapi 服务器,搭配 MongoDB 数据存储,提供了一站式的解决方案。

项目介绍

appy 结构清晰,功能完备,它的前端基于流行的 Vue.js 2.5.16,采用 AdminLTE 的UI模板,呈现出专业且直观的管理界面。后端则采用 hapi 服务器,通过 rest-hapi 插件实现RESTful API接口,数据库管理则依托于 MongoDB。

appy-dashboard

如果你只需要一个API服务器,可以尝试其姊妹项目 appy-backend

你可以在这里体验实时演示:appyapp.io/#live_demo

技术分析

  • Vue.js:作为前端的核心,Vue.js 提供了响应式的数据绑定和组件化的能力,使得页面构建更加灵活且易于维护。

  • AdminLTE:提供了美观的后台管理界面,拥有多种预设的界面元素和布局,让开发者能够快速搭建出专业级别的应用。

  • hapirest-hapi:这是一个强大且可扩展的后端架构,支持直接通过RESTful API与前端进行通信,方便数据交互。

  • MongoDB:强大的文档型数据库,适合处理JSON结构数据,为Appy提供了稳定的数据存储支持。

应用场景

Appy 极适用于以下场景:

  • 快速原型开发:你需要在短时间内创建一个功能完整的MVP,以验证产品概念或展示给投资者。

  • 中小型企业后台系统:其良好的用户体验和强大的管理功能,使Appy成为中小型企业后台系统的理想选择。

  • 教育和学习平台:开发者可以通过Appy学习如何构建现代Web应用,因为它集成了多种流行的技术。

项目特点

  • 多环境支持:只需Docker,你就能轻松运行Appy。此外,还提供了没有Docker的安装选项,满足不同开发需求。

  • 一键种子数据:内置数据种子脚本,可以快速填充数据库,帮助你迅速启动项目。

  • 分层架构:前后端分离,使得代码组织清晰,便于团队协作和后期维护。

  • 全面的API文档:集成Swagger,无需额外配置,即可获取详细的API接口文档。

  • 预设角色:预设了普通用户、管理员和超级管理员角色,满足常见的权限管理需求。

立即行动,用Appy开启你的高效开发之旅吧!无论是初创项目还是企业级应用,Appy都能为你提供坚实的基础设施支持。要了解更多详情,还可以查阅 appy-backend wiki

热门项目推荐

项目优选

收起
Python-100-DaysPython-100-Days
Python - 100天从新手到大师
Python
266
55
国产编程语言蓝皮书国产编程语言蓝皮书
《国产编程语言蓝皮书》-编委会工作区
65
17
Cangjie-ExamplesCangjie-Examples
本仓将收集和展示高质量的仓颉示例代码,欢迎大家投稿,让全世界看到您的妙趣设计,也让更多人通过您的编码理解和喜爱仓颉语言。
Cangjie
196
45
openHiTLSopenHiTLS
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
53
44
HarmonyOS-ExamplesHarmonyOS-Examples
本仓将收集和展示仓颉鸿蒙应用示例代码,欢迎大家投稿,在仓颉鸿蒙社区展现你的妙趣设计!
Cangjie
268
69
qwerty-learnerqwerty-learner
为键盘工作者设计的单词记忆与英语肌肉记忆锻炼软件 / Words learning and English muscle memory training software designed for keyboard workers
TSX
333
27
CangjieCommunityCangjieCommunity
为仓颉编程语言开发者打造活跃、开放、高质量的社区环境
Markdown
896
0
advanced-javaadvanced-java
Advanced-Java是一个Java进阶教程,适合用于学习Java高级特性和编程技巧。特点:内容深入、实例丰富、适合进阶学习。
JavaScript
419
108
MateChatMateChat
前端智能化场景解决方案UI库,轻松构建你的AI应用,我们将持续完善更新,欢迎你的使用与建议。 官网地址:https://matechat.gitcode.com
144
24
HarmonyOS-Cangjie-CasesHarmonyOS-Cangjie-Cases
参考 HarmonyOS-Cases/Cases,提供仓颉开发鸿蒙 NEXT 应用的案例集
Cangjie
58
4